I made two pano's with an html5 output. How do you deliver this to your customers? I have to use the exact url's the customer is going to use. I think there are two options: the customer tells me me what I have to use as url's or he's going to change this by himself, but is this possible without the use of Pano2VR?

Hi,
Once I complete a project, I upload it to my server and email a link so the customer can view. Normally I remove it after a couple of days as it is only for the customer to see and approve the work. Once the customer is happy I package up all the files that make up the project in a zip and upload it on my server. I then email the customer with the link after the invoice is paid :D.
It is then up to the customer to get their web developer to embed the files. The developer can rename the HTML file as required as it will not effect code in the page.
So you don't have anything to de with Domains or Hosting.

Hi,
The Pano2VR web page has all the code a web developer requires to find out how to embed in to their own page.
The zip you would send has an HTML page so you are providing a complete working product.

The HTML page from Pano2VR can be borderless, your customer can link directly to this from a link from their own webpage.
If they want the panorama in their own page then they will need to hire a developer.
This is one of the things that should be agreed BRFORE you take on the job.
